We've all been there. You take 30 to 60 minutes out of your day to listen to an interview in hopes of hearing something you've not heard before; something that will truly impact you and your career. The interview ends and that's all you've heard is one more story about how someone got started in their career or climbed the corporate ladder. Important? Yes. Impactful? Not always. What differentiates the 3Q podcast from all others is that it will never take more than 15 minutes of your time and every guest will be asked to respond to the same three questions. Hosted by Rachel Vogel

About Jeremy:


Jeremy Gruber is the Head of Artist Marketing & Digital Strategy at Friends At Work, representing artists including John Legend and Charlie Puth among many others. Jeremy has spent over a decade working with artists at all levels helping them grow their brand and businesses by bringing together traditional marketing with the latest technology. After graduating with a Music Industry degree from USC, Jeremy started his career helping to manage the wine label, public speaking and corporate career of Mick Fleetwood at Sabre Entertainment. He then ran digital for 10th Street Entertainment and Eleven Seven Music working with bands including Mötley Crüe, Papa Roach, and Blondie. In 2010, he joined Concord Music Group helping to establish the direct to consumer team and build the digital marketing & strategy department where he worked with legends like Paul Simon, Paul McCartney, and James Taylor. Jeremy was also an adjunct professor in the USC Music Industry Program where he taught music marketing for six years, and was a partner in the marketing tech platform, found.ee which sold to Downtown Music in 2021. In addition to his work with artists, he frequently advises music tech startups and is passionate about mentoring future music executives and artists.
